201120220101107 has 2 divisors, whose sum is σ = 201120220101108. Its totient is φ = 201120220101106.

The previous prime is 201120220101049. The next prime is 201120220101109. The reversal of 201120220101107 is 701101022021102.

It is a happy number.

It is a strong prime.

It is a cyclic number.

It is not a de Polignac number, because 201120220101107 - 210 = 201120220100083 is a prime.

Together with 201120220101109, it forms a pair of twin primes.

It is a Chen prime.

It is not a weakly prime, because it can be changed into another prime (201120220101109) by changing a digit.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 100560110050553 + 100560110050554.

It is an arithmetic number, because the mean of its divisors is an integer number (100560110050554).

Almost surely, 2201120220101107 is an apocalyptic number.

201120220101107 is a deficient number, since it is larger than the sum of its proper divisors (1).

201120220101107 is an equidigital number, since it uses as much as digits as its factorization.

201120220101107 is an evil number, because the sum of its binary digits is even.

The product of its (nonzero) digits is 112, while the sum is 20.

Adding to 201120220101107 its reverse (701101022021102), we get a palindrome (902221242122209).
